1. The Wisest King

One of the most notable facts about King Solomon is his unparalleled wisdom. The Bible recounts a famous story where two women claimed the same baby. Solomon proposed to cut the baby in half, exposing the true mother, who immediately gave up her claim to save the child. This story illustrates not only his wisdom but also his cleverness in discerning the truth.

2. Builder of the First Temple

Solomon is credited with building the First Temple in Jerusalem, a significant religious structure for the Israelites. This temple became the center of Jewish worship and housed the Ark of the Covenant. The architectural style influenced many subsequent structures, underscoring Solomon’s legacy as a master builder.

4. His Many Wives

To strengthen alliances, Solomon married numerous foreign women, reportedly totaling 700 wives and 300 concubines. This practice, while common among monarchs of the time, also led to complications, including the introduction of foreign idols into Israelite culture.

1. The Wisdom of Solomon

King Solomon is renowned for his exceptional wisdom, often encapsulated in the phrase “the wisdom of Solomon.” According to the biblical account in 1 Kings 3:5-14, Solomon was given the opportunity to ask God for anything. He requested wisdom, which led to his famous ruling over two women claiming to be the mother of the same child. His insightful judgment not only saved the child but also showcased the depth of his understanding.

2. The Construction of the First Temple

Under Solomon’s reign, the First Temple in Jerusalem, also known as Solomon’s Temple, was constructed. This magnificent edifice, completed around 957 BCE, served as a central place of worship for the Israelites. The temple’s intricate design and dedication rituals are detailed in the Book of Kings. Unlike any of its time, it included gold embellishments and sacred artifacts, making it a revered location for Jewish worship.

7. The Political Alliances Formed

Solomon strategically formed alliances through marriage, most notably with the Pharaoh of Egypt by marrying his daughter. This practice was common in Ancient Near East politics, allowing Solomon to secure peace and strengthen his kingdom’s influence. Such alliances often provided economic and military advantages, demonstrating Solomon’s astute leadership skills.

8. Solomon’s Use of Forced Labor

To build his monumental structures, Solomon employed forced labor, mainly from the Canaanite populations. While this enabled the swift completion of his projects, it raised ethical issues that led to discontent among the Israelite people. Later, this discontent would have significant consequences for his successors, showcasing the complexity of Solomon’s reign.

11. Solomon’s Role in Islam

In Islamic tradition, Solomon (known as Sulaiman) is considered a prophet and a king. The Qur’an references his abilities, including communicating with animals and controlling the winds. This acknowledgment across religions speaks volumes about the universal respect and reverence held for Solomon, showcasing his multifaceted role in both historical and spiritual contexts.

12. The Archaeological Evidence

Archaeological efforts to corroborate Solomon’s reign have produced mixed results. While some artifacts suggest a prosperous kingdom, definitive evidence of Solomon’s Temple remains elusive. Excavations in Jerusalem continue to uncover insights into this era, providing a deeper understanding of the cultural and historical backdrop against which Solomon thrived.
